    I am traveling with my Mom, DM? driving her home from Baltimore to Arlington, TX. So, I thought that this might be a great chance to find some new quilt shops along the way. Or also meet with anyone that has the time.

    I am in Lexington, VA tonight, and will drive down HWY 81 to 40, passing thru Knoxville to Nashville sometime Thursday, hopefully spending time either in Nashville or Memphis. I don't know where I'll be on Friday, but it will be along those lines. I'll check the board for responses, hope to hear from you!

    There is a terrific shop in Jonesborough, TN - Tennessee Quilts. It is a little off the path of 81, but worth the slight detour. Mammaw's Thimble is on Papermill in Knoxville. It is very easy to get to from 40, just west of the downtown area. There is another fairly large shop in West Knoxville near the Lovell Road exit of 40 called Gina's Bernina. If you want more specifics, pm me and I'll send some info, although you could probably Google the maps. Oh, and if you are going through Hagerstown, MD to get to 81, there is a great shop there - Wilson's. It is a little north of where 70 joins 81.
